Web2 apr. 2024 · Remove affected items and use baking soda, activated charcoal, or an ozone generator to neutralize odors. Deep clean surfaces, including walls and floors, with water and vinegar or other cleaning solutions. In extreme cases, contact a professional cleaning service specializing in smoke remediation.
